How Our Team Handles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ection

When you hire our team for sewage cleanup and disinfection, you can expect a thorough process that focuses on your safety and property. We’ll start by assessing the damage and identifying the source of the problem. Our technicians will then use specialized equipment to remove standing water, decontaminate affected areas, and disinfect surfaces to prevent the growth of bacteria and other microorganisms.

Step 1: Assessment and Preparation

We’ll begin by assessing the extent of the damage and identifying the source of the problem. Our technicians will then take steps to contain the affected area and prevent further contamination. This may involve sealing off affected rooms or areas to prevent cross-contamination.

Step 2: Water Removal and Drying

We’ll use specialized equipment to remove standing water and speed up the drying process. Our technicians will carefully extract water from affected areas using pumps and wet vacuums, and then use high-velocity fans and dehumidifiers to dry out the space.

Step 3: Disinfection and Decontamination

We’ll use eco-friendly disinfectants and decontamination techniques to remove bacteria, viruses, and other microorganisms. Our technicians will carefully disinfect all surfaces, including walls, floors, and furniture, to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Odor Control

We’ll use specialized equipment to remove unpleasant odors and sanitize the affected area. Our technicians will use odor-neutralizing products and equipment to remove lingering smells and leave your space smelling fresh and clean.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Completion

We’ll conduct a thorough inspection to ensure that all work is complete and your property is safe and clean. Our technicians will also provide you with a detailed report and any necessary documentation to support your insurance claim.

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ection Cost in Flowing Wells, AZ

The cost of sewage cleanup and disinfection var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Flowing Wells, AZ. Our team provides free estimates and will work with you to find out the best course of action for your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Removal $500 – $2,500 The extent of water damage and the size of the affected area.
Disinfection and Decontamination $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the type of disinfectants and equipment used.
Sanitizing and Odor Control $500 – $2,000 The severity of the odor and the size of the affected area.
Final Inspection and Completion Free N/A
